    Abstract: A system for tracking usage patterns of electrical appliances is disclosed. The system comprises a central database configured to receive and store information; a plurality of energy sensors each of the plurality of sensors being configured to measure a change in electrical energy use by a corresponding one of a plurality of electrical appliances; at least one presence sensor configured to determine when at least one user is proximate to the plurality of electrical appliances and send presence information to the central database; and a processor configured to extract features from such information and create at least one user profile corresponding to the at least one user and a pattern of electrical energy use associated with the at least one user based on said features.

    Abstract: A method for decomposing Electro-Derma Activity signals from a user to infer response to content commences by first high-pass filtering the raw EDA signals collected from a user to reduce the influence of tonic signals. The high-pass filtered EDA signals are then fitted to a dictionary of feasible skin conductance response signals.

    Abstract: A method for determining user responses to content commences by collecting Electro-Dermal Activity (EDA) signals from a user via a collection system as the user consumes (e.g., views) the content. From the collected EDA signals, the amplitudes of the users' responses are extracted at particular times. The extracted amplitudes undergo processing with demographic information for the user and parameters of the collection system obtained during training to predict feedback of the user to the content.

    Abstract: A method, apparatus and system for determining viewer reaction to content elements include generating a viewer feedback signal by recording biometric measurements of a viewer's reactions to viewed content, synchronizing the viewer feedback signal with a content metadata signal for the viewed content and correlating the biometric measurements in the viewer feedback signal with respective elements in the content metadata signal to determine a viewer reaction score for the respective elements in the content.

    Abstract: The invention relates to a method of detecting an anomaly in traffic containing a plurality of flows. Each flow has a plurality of flow features. The method including the steps of: (i) dividing the traffic into a plurality of sets, on the basis a first flow feature, such that the flows in at least one of the sets have a common value for the first flow feature (ii) determining that the anomaly is present in one of the sets and, (iii) dividing the set in which the anomaly is present on the basis of a second flow feature, such that the flows in at least one of the resulting sets have a common value for the second flow feature.
